Lecturer in Uniformed Services - JRN0129
Cirencester
Lecturer in Uniformed Services
Salary: £31,339- £46,059 per annum
(Salary dependent on qualifications and experience)
Contract: Full Time/Permanent
Required From: 26th August 2025

Candidates should have a commitment to further education and be motivated to achieve high standards in teaching and learning. The ability to work well within teams and to adapt to curriculum demands is essential. Ideally candidates should possess a good honours degree and a teaching qualification.
Here at Cirencester, we teach the Pearson level 3 uniform protective services. If you have experience teaching this or similar specifications or even experience of teaching other levels and specifications (e.g., at level 4 or 5) do not hesitate to apply. Experience in associated sectors (e.g., armed forces, fire service, police service, ambulance service) is also very valuable. If you have the experience and a desire to teach, but do not yet have the teaching qualification, still apply.
The post holder will be expected to:
Teach to a high standard, and develop the relevant skills to teach truly outstanding provision
Candidates should have a commitment to providing high quality learning to enable all learners to achieve their full potential. The ability to truly work as a team player is also essential. The post holder will be expected to demonstrate outstanding organisational and interpersonal skills.
Candidates should possess either proven experience in industry or a good honours degree in a related subject (or a combination of both). Ideally you will hold a teaching qualification, or be committed to obtaining a level 5 teaching qualification when in post.

Benefits include Teachers Pensions defined benefit pension scheme – 28.6% college pension contribution (including life assurance), generous holidays, sick pay scheme, Employee Assistance Programme, free on-site car parking, on-site fitness suite, refectory and Cycle to Work Scheme.
